Operations
Description
The 3devo Filament Maker Two transforms plastic waste or raw pellets into high-quality 3D printing filament. By converting discarded materials into reusable filament, it reduces reliance on virgin plastics and minimizes waste disposal. Its precise temperature control and automation ensure consistent filament quality, supporting closed-loop manufacturing. This enables users to recycle in-house, cut material costs, and lower their environmental footprint while fostering sustainable innovation in prototyping and production.
Operating Principles
The 3devo Filament Maker Two operates by melting plastic pellets or shredded waste and extruding them into uniform filament strands. It features precise temperature control, adjustable speed, and automated diameter measurement to ensure consistent quality. The machine supports various plastic types and offers easy operation through an intuitive interface. Benefits to the end user include cost savings by recycling materials, reduced environmental impact, and access to custom filament tailored to specific printing needs. Its reliability and precision enhance 3D printing results, making it ideal for prototyping, production, and sustainable manufacturing practices.
